3 AAP councillors join BJP, boost its chances in mayoral poll

NEW DELHI: Three AAP councilors switched over to the BJP on Saturday, boosting its chances of victory in the upcoming MCD mayoral poll.

Welcoming the councilors, city BJP president Virendra Sachdeva said Delhi will have a “triple engine” government — at the Centre, assembly and municipal level — at the right time to develop it as the capital of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s vision under a ‘Viksit Bharat”.

The three councilors are Anita Basoya (Andrews Ganj), Nikhil Chaprana (Hari Nagar) and Dharamvir (R K Puram). PTI
